ALTER TABLE `zh_change_apply` ADD `total_price` DECIMAL(30,8) NULL DEFAULT NULL COMMENT '金额' AFTER `content`, ADD `decimal` VARCHAR(1000) NULL DEFAULT NULL COMMENT '小数位数设置JSON' AFTER `total_price`; CREATE TABLE `zh_change_plan` ( `id` int(11) NOT NULL AUTO_INCREMENT, `tid` int(11) NOT NULL COMMENT '标段id', `selected` tinyint(4) UNSIGNED NOT NULL DEFAULT 0 COMMENT '报表用,是否选择', `uid` int(11) NOT NULL COMMENT '发起人', `code`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NOT NULL COMMENT '变更方案编号', `name`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NOT NULL COMMENT '变更工程名称', `in_time` datetime NOT NULL COMMENT '发起时间', `status` tinyint(2) NOT NULL COMMENT '方案状态', `times` tinyint(2) NOT NULL COMMENT '审批次数', `apply_code`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'变更申请编号', `org_name`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'原设计图名称', `peg`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'桩号', `new_code`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'图号', `c_new_code`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'变更图号', `design_name`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'变更设计名称', `class`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'工程变更类别', `quality`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'工程变更性质', `reason` text C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L COMMENT '变更原因', `content` text C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L COMMENT '变更内容', `memo` text C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L COMMENT '方案描述', `total_price` decimal(30, 8) NULL DEFAULT NULL COMMENT '金额', `decimal` varchar(1000)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'小数位数设置JSON', PRIMARY KEY (`id`) USING BTREE ) ENGINE = InnoDB CHARACTER SET = utf8 COLLATE = utf8_unicode_ci COMMENT = '变更方案表' ROW_FORMAT = Dynamic; -- ---------------------------- -- Table structure for zh_change_plan_attachment -- ---------------------------- CREATE TABLE `zh_change_plan_attachment` ( `id` int(11) NOT NULL AUTO_INCREMENT, `tid` int(11) NOT NULL COMMENT '标段id', `cpid` int(11) NOT NULL COMMENT '方案id', `uid` int(11) NOT NULL COMMENT '上传者id', `filename`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NOT NULL COMMENT '文件名称', `fileext` varchar(5) CHARACTER SET utf8 COLLATE utf8_unicode_ci NOT NULL COMMENT '文件后缀', `filesize`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NOT NULL COMMENT '文件大小', `filepath`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NOT NULL COMMENT '文件存储路径', `upload_time` datetime NOT NULL COMMENT '上传时间', `extra_upload` tinyint(1) NOT NULL DEFAULT 0 COMMENT '是否为审核通过后再次上传的文件,0为否', PRIMARY KEY (`id`) USING BTREE, INDEX `idx_cid`(`cpid`) USING BTREE ) ENGINE = InnoDB CHARACTER SET = utf8 COLLATE = utf8_unicode_ci COMMENT = '变更立项附件表' ROW_FORMAT = Dynamic; -- ---------------------------- -- Table structure for zh_change_plan_audit -- ---------------------------- CREATE TABLE `zh_change_plan_audit` ( `id` int(11) NOT NULL AUTO_INCREMENT COMMENT '主键', `tid` int(11) NOT NULL COMMENT '标段id', `cpid` int(11) NOT NULL COMMENT '方案id', `aid` int(11) NOT NULL COMMENT '审批人id', `order` int(11) NOT NULL COMMENT '审批顺序', `times` int(11) NOT NULL COMMENT '审批次数', `status` tinyint(1) NOT NULL COMMENT '审批状态', `begin_time` datetime NULL DEFAULT NULL COMMENT '开始审批时间', `end_time` datetime NULL DEFAULT NULL COMMENT '结束审批时间', `opinion` varchar(1000)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'审批意见', PRIMARY KEY (`id`) USING BTREE ) ENGINE = InnoDB CHARACTER SET = utf8 COLLATE = utf8_unicode_ci COMMENT = '变更立项审批表' ROW_FORMAT = Dynamic; -- ---------------------------- -- Table structure for zh_change_plan_list -- ---------------------------- CREATE TABLE `zh_change_plan_list` ( `id` int(11) NOT NULL AUTO_INCREMENT, `tid` int(11) NOT NULL COMMENT '标段id', `cpid` int(11) NOT NULL COMMENT '方案id', `code`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'清单编号', `name`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'清单名称', `unit` varchar(50)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'单位', `unit_price` decimal(30, 8) NULL DEFAULT NULL COMMENT '单价', `oamount` decimal(30, 8) NULL DEFAULT NULL COMMENT '原数量', `camount` decimal(30, 8) NULL DEFAULT NULL COMMENT '变更数量', `samount` decimal(30, 8) NULL DEFAULT NULL COMMENT '审批完成后变更数量', `audit_amount` varchar(1000)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'用户填的数目,json', `spamount` decimal(30, 8) NULL DEFAULT NULL COMMENT '审批流程中读取数量', PRIMARY KEY (`id`) USING BTREE ) ENGINE = InnoDB CHARACTER SET = utf8 COLLATE = utf8_unicode_ci COMMENT = '变更方案清单表' ROW_FORMAT = Dynamic; ALTER TABLE `zh_material` ADD `period` VARCHAR(255) NULL DEFAULT NULL COMMENT '调差周期' AFTER `s_order`; ALTER TABLE `zh_tender` ADD `c_apply_list_rule` VARCHAR(255) NULL DEFAULT NULL COMMENT '变更申请统一原设计数量读取规则' AFTER `pos_file`, ADD `c_plan_list_rule` VARCHAR(255) NULL DEFAULT NULL COMMENT '变更方案统一原设计数量读取规则' AFTER `c_apply_list_rule`; ALTER TABLE `zh_change` ADD `plan_code` VARCHAR(255) NULL DEFAULT NULL COMMENT '变更方案编号' AFTER `name`; CREATE TABLE `zh_change_apply_list` ( `id` int(11) NOT NULL AUTO_INCREMENT, `tid` int(11) NOT NULL COMMENT '标段id', `caid` int(11) NOT NULL COMMENT '申请id', `code`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'清单编号', `name` varchar(255)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'清单名称', `unit` varchar(50) CHARACTER SET utf8 COLLATE utf8_unicode_ci NULL DEFAULT NULL COMMENT '单位', `unit_price` decimal(30, 8) NULL DEFAULT NULL COMMENT '单价', `oamount` decimal(30, 8) NULL DEFAULT NULL COMMENT '原数量', `camount` decimal(30, 8) NULL DEFAULT NULL COMMENT '变更数量', PRIMARY KEY (`id`) USING BTREE ) ENGINE = InnoDB CHARACTER SET = utf8 COLLATE = utf8_unicode_ci COMMENT = '变更申请清单表' ROW_FORMAT = Dynamic;